#0A2633 Color
#0A2633 is rgb(10, 38, 51) in RGB, hsl(199, 67%, 12%) in HSL, and about cmyk(80%, 25%, 0%, 80%) in CMYK. It has no registered color name of its own — the closest is Gunmetal (#2A3439), visibly different at ΔE 10.87. White text is the more readable choice on this background.

#0A2633 Channel Values
How #0A2633 breaks down in each color model. Hue is measured in degrees around the color wheel; saturation, lightness, and the CMYK inks are percentages.
| Model | Channels | Notes |
|---|---|---|
| RGB | R 10 · G 38 · B 51 | 8-bit channels as sent to the display |
| HSL | H 199° · S 67% · L 12% | Easiest model for building lighter and darker variants |
| HSV | H 199° · S 80% · V 20% | Matches the picker in most design tools |
| CMYK | C 80% · M 25% · Y 0% · K 80% | Approximate ink mix; confirm with an ICC profile before printing |
| Luminance | 15.7:1 vs white · 1.34:1 vs black | WCAG 2.2 relative-luminance contrast ratios |
Text Contrast & Accessibility
WCAG 2.2 contrast ratios for text on a #0A2633 background. AA requires 4.5:1 for normal text and 3:1 for large text; AAA requires 7:1. Contrast is one check, not a full accessibility review.

#0A2633 Frequently Asked Questions
What color is #0A2633?
#0A2633 is a darkest teal — rgb(10, 38, 51) in RGB and hsl(199, 67%, 12%) in HSL. It carries no registered color name of its own; the closest named color is Gunmetal (#2A3439), which is visibly different at a CIE76 distance of 10.87.
What is the RGB value of #0A2633?
#0A2633 is rgb(10, 38, 51) — red 10, green 38, and blue 51 on the 0-255 scale.
What is the CMYK value of #0A2633?
#0A2633 converts to approximately cmyk(80%, 25%, 0%, 80%). CMYK output is a mathematical approximation for planning; confirm production print colors with your printer and ICC profile.
Should text on #0A2633 be black or white?
White text is the more readable choice. #0A2633 scores 15.7:1 against white and 1.34:1 against black, and WCAG 2.2 asks for at least 4.5:1 for normal body text.
Can I write #0A2633 as a CSS color keyword?
No. #0A2633 is not one of the CSS color keywords, so it has to be written as a hex, rgb() or hsl() value. The closest keyword is black (#000000) at a CIE76 distance of 19.28, which is visibly different.
